TURBAN HEAD FIVE DOLLARS OR HALF EAGLE – EAGLE AND SHIELD ON REVERSE

Heraldic Eagle Reverse – Capped Bust – Head Facing Right (1795-1807)

Designer – Engraver: Robert Scot
Metal Composition: 92% Gold – 8% Silver and Copper
Diameter: 25 mm
Mass / Weight: 8.75 grams

1806. Pointed 6. BD-1, Rarity 4. NGC XF Details, repaired. Repaired on the obverse. Estimated Value $1,100 - 1,200. The William H & Beuelaress K. Helem Collection. Categories: $5.00 Gold
